Output 8b4ca17660b0c192761ea367c91e2124dc133c733e8f169aa41c7aeabfe22a82:27

value
309052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fad08bd6406cc8fe1380102116e546473d070ab OP_EQUAL
address
34aWA7XR1LobqNqyF7uT3J3pfS8i1v3yms
transaction
8b4ca17660b0c192761ea367c91e2124dc133c733e8f169aa41c7aeabfe22a82
spent
true